United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is looking for an Experienced Social Worker to join the Assessment and Care team in Liverpool. This role is focused on contributing to an effective Adult Social Care Service and involves responsibilities such as safeguarding and planning individual support.
The successful candidate will identify needs, co-design support plans, and manage their own caseload while ensuring compliance with national procedures. We welcome applications from individuals with the necessary skills and commitment to improving outcomes for adults with care needs.

How to prepare for a job interview at United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you’re well-versed in the key responsibilities of a Senior Social Worker, especially around safeguarding and support planning. Brush up on national procedures and be ready to discuss how you've applied these in your previous roles.
✨Showcase Your Experience
Prepare specific examples from your past work that highlight your ability to identify needs and co-design support plans.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ers and make them impactful.
✨Demonstrate Your Commitment
United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is looking for someone dedicated to improving outcomes for adults with care needs. Be ready to share your passion for social work and any initiatives you’ve taken to enhance service delivery in your previous positions.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
At the end of the interview, have a few insightful questions prepared about the team dynamics or the challenges faced by the Assessment and Care team.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
